Wickham Hotel Structural Remediation

wickam

Project no. 5961

Built in 1885 the hotel is a 3-storey heritage listed building, framed with timber and masonry. 
At the time of appointment, upper floors had been closed to patrons and staff for several months, significantly effecting commercial revenue.
Inspection and structural review was undertaken of the weather damaged 1st floor balcony and dilapidated fire escape.
Cost effective remediation solutions were provided to facilitate full use of the upper floors for assembly areas without fixed seating as nominated by AS1170.1:2002.
